Point Boston Peninsula Club by Makmax AustraliaMakmax Australia is proud to be a part of the ocean-front venue and attraction, the Point Boston Peninsula Club- located on the coast of a $450 million environmentally sustainable residential community, the South Australia's Eyre Peninsula. The iconic venue features Makmax Australia's eye-catching and unique glass-house design and a custom-designed membrane roof- which together creates a natural dining experience with a spectacular view of the coasts.
For the building of the Point Boston Peninsula clubhouse facility, the project needed a design that plays well with the beauty of the coastline while maintaining the peninsula's natural charm and heritage. Makmax Australia's tensile membranes provided a lightweight and flexible material that allowed the architect to design a stunning roof structure which will look equally captivating by daylight as it is during the night- with artistic lighting.
The Point Boston Peninsula Club project won an Outstanding Achievement for Makmax Australia at the STA Australian Textiles Industry Awards 2009 and an Excellence award at the IFAI International Achievement Awards in 2009. The flexibility, durability, and sustainability of the tensile material supplied by Makmax made it a perfect choice for this project.
